Obituary for James Elton Nycklemoe

James Elton Nycklemoe, age 93 of Richfield. A loving husband, father, grandpa and great-grandpa passed away October 24, 2020. Born November 11, 1926 in Minneapolis, MN to John and Emma Nycklemoe. Preceded in death by wife, Ruth; brother, Palmer Nycklemoe; sisters, Mayme Brustad and Eileen Toebe. Survived by wife, Naomi; children, Steven (Bill Anagnost)) Nycklemoe, Jane (Wayne) Davis and Jeffrey (Cheryl) Nycklemoe; 7 grandchildren; 17 great-grandchildren; brother-in-law, Toebe; other family and friends. James was a proud Norwegian - Minnesotan, Naval Serviceman, Architectural Draftsman, Home Builder, Craftsman, Habitat for Humanity participant, travel and camping enthusiast, Lutheran, Tenor, Twins Fan, Math Tutor, volunteer, college provider. He was an active member of Oak Grove Lutheran Church where he sang in their Senior Choir. He was also a member of the Silver Notes Community Choir. A life well lived. Private family services. Interment Fort Snelling National Cemetery.
